Prime Minister gives "hot" instructions on Can Gio international super port

Việt NamViệt Nam06/12/2024

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h assigned the Ministry of Transport to coordinate with the Ministry of Planning and Investment to complete procedures related to Can Gio International Transit Port in December.
Can Gio International Transit Port has a total investment of more than 5 billion USD (equivalent to 128,000 billion VND) and is divided into 7 phases. Of which, phase 1 will be put into operation in 2027 and completed in 2045. With its location near international shipping routes passing through the East Sea, this is considered a super port project because it has many competitive advantages, attracting international goods from countries in the region such as Cambodia, Thailand, Brunei, Philippines, southern China... Recently, at the 5th Southeast Regional Coordination Council Conference with the theme "Double-digit economic growth in the Southeast region by 2025: Challenges, opportunities and solutions",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h gave clear instructions on this super port project.

Perspective of Can Gio International Transit Port Project

Accordingly, the Prime Minister emphasized the urgent need to resolve difficulties and promote key projects in the region with a specific roadmap. For the Can Gio International Transit Port Project, the Government leader assigned the Ministry of Transport to coordinate with the Ministry of Planning and Investment to complete procedures in December. Previously, in March 2024, Ho Chi Minh City submitted to the Prime Minister a Project to study the construction of Can Gio International Transit Port, putting into operation phase 1 before 2030. According to the Project, the location of Can Gio International Transit Port will be located in Con Cho Islet (Thanh An Commune, Can Gio District). This is located at the mouth of Cai Mep - Thi Vai River, in Ganh Rai Bay, near international shipping routes passing through the East Sea, convenient for developing an international transit port. The project is expected to be competitive with Singapore and Malaysia.

According to the report of the Department of Transport of Ho Chi Minh City, the Project on Research and Construction of Can Gio International Transit Port sets the goal of building the port into an international transit center of Ho Chi Minh City, attracting shipping lines, transport companies, cargo owners and logistics service businesses at home and abroad to participate in the world transport supply chain. The total length of the main port is expected to be about 7km with a barge berth expected to be about 2km. The total area of the port is estimated at 571ha, of which about 469.5ha includes wharves, warehouses, internal traffic, housing areas for operating staff, technical infrastructure... and 101.5ha is the port's operating water area. It is estimated that the first year's cargo throughput through the port can reach 2.1 million TEUs (1 TEU equals 1 20-foot container). After 7 investment phases, the volume of goods passing through Can Gio International Transit Port will reach about 16.9 million TEUs by 2047, contributing to the budget 34,000 - 40,000 billion VND per year when operating at full capacity.
